First story about our trip.
You know how we always say make sure you have backups for your backups - believe me you need to follow that rule. We were in an area that it would have been a 12 hour trip through various forms of transportation to find the parts of civilization that knew what ecigs were.
I took 3 devices and had extra everything. Two devices died/were destroyed - turns out Vamos do not hold up well when dropped from the back of a motorcycle speeding down the road. The next device just fried the chip and beyond that do not know what went wrong, but my last device with some assistance from some plastic wrap (to hard to explain) and epoxy glue survived until I dropped it in the trash upon my trip home - just to let you know - it was my old (4.5yrs old) Joyetech Ego that survived the trip - well- kind of survived...
Juice - this was the hard one to plan. I had some left in the Philippines from last years trip, but I did not want to count on it for use in case it went bad - so - I mixed one 30ml bottle for each week of my trip and one extra bottle for good measure - 10 bottles in all - well surprise surprise surprise - when I got to the Philippines I only had 6 bottles - four were left on my dresser to be put in my backpack as part of my carry on luggage, but dumb old me forgot... Luckily the old juice that I had left in the Philippines was still vapable - a little dark and peppery, but still vapable...
So when you are headed out the door for a long trip - double up on all of what you thought you needed to take and double check it all before you walk out the door - I got lucky and will not get caught like that again...
But I did have enough backups and juice (sort of)... And I did survive...
